Mark Walker explores the concept of burnout as a problem of meaning and awareness rather than just discipline.
Send us Fan Mail Burnout isn’t always about doing too much. Sometimes it’s the hollow kind, where you’re busy, tired, and still feel disconnected from your own life. Mark Walker starts from a raw social media post: a young guy stuck in a numb loop of eat, work, scroll, sleep. People pile on with labels like “lazy,” but I take it somewhere more useful and more compassionate: what if the real issue is awareness and meaning, not discipline?
